National Pike Health Center, Inc. is a licensed Community based Outpatient Mental Clinic (OMHC) and Psychiatric Rehabilitation Program (PRP) serving children, adolescents, and adults in the Dundalk, Catonsville, and Baltimore metropolitan area since 2001. National Pike Health Center, Inc. started out in 2001 on Baltimore National Pike (the source of the name).

The multidisciplinary team of mental health therapists, rehabilitation coordinators, and administrative staff headed by Cortina Darden, LCSW-C who designates services based on the initial assessment and the final diagnostic evaluation.
There is ongoing planning and review of each case from inception, through treatment until the client is discharged. Our outpatient mental health services are designed to be preventative as well as therapeutic. Treatment and psychiatric rehabilitation are based on individualized treatment and/or rehabilitation goals set and monitored as the services continue.
If we find that a child or adolescent is no longer responding to this level of care and needs more intensive mental health therapy, we will refer to another facility that can better serve that client.
